How much does a medical receptionist earn in Wichita, KS?
The average medical receptionist in Wichita, KS earns between $21,000 and $32,000 annually. This compares to the national average medical receptionist range of $26,000 to $38,000.
Average medical receptionist salary in Wichita, KS
$26,000
